About  Brooke Lierman
Delegate Brooke Lierman is a disability and civil rights attorney, mother of two, and state legislator. Brooke joined the General Assembly in 2015, spent five years as a Member of the Appropriations Committee before assuming a leadership role on the Environment and Transportation Committee in 2019. She is also the House Chair for the Joint Committee on Pensions, sits on the Joint Committee on Ending Homelessness, and founded and formerly co-chaired the Maryland Transit Caucus. Brooke has successfully passed landmark legislation to invest in and improve public transit; end suspension and expulsion of young students; fund evidence-based gun violence prevention programs; aid sex trafficking victims; close loopholes in our family and paid leave laws and much more. In 2019, working with environmental groups and small businesses around the state, she passed the nation’s first statewide ban on Styrofoam food and beverage containers, and in 2020 she passed the HOME Act, banning housing discrimination based on the renter’s source of income. 

Brooke is a powerful advocate for her constituents and a champion for families and small businesses around the state. Amidst the health and economic crises created by COVID-19, she has organized food relief for constituents and led the successful effort to bring World Central Kitchen to Baltimore to feed thousands in need. About New Politics
New Politics is a bipartisan organization that revitalizes American democracy by recruiting, developing, and electing leaders who have committed their lives to serving our country, either through the military or national service organizations like AmeriCorps or the Peace Corps. New Politics support includes strategic advising and training in all aspects of a candidate’s campaign, such as fundraising, communications, organizing, hiring, and team building. New Politics has raised more than $8.5 million for their candidates, electing more than 30 of them to office, from Congress to School Board.
